@remi

It probably worked in your case because your text editor made word wrapping after the space char, so the 2 links were treated as 2 long words in 2 lines.
Without word wrapping (one long line with 160 chars) - only part1 is automatically parsed by jD.
After clicking "Add URL(s)" - that little editor also wraps the two URLs to 2 lines and then both links are parsed correctly.

So the little problem is with automatic parse.
The same minor bug in Nightly and Stable.
